Want to Exit Smoothly? Start Now

By: Raynor Large, Business Advisor Too often, a Seller lets external forces push them out. Unfortunately, selling a business isn’t like selling a home; a buyer’s due diligence looks deeper than the fresh coat of paint and some curb appeal. Instead, the Seller needs to start their planning years in advance for an ideal outcome.
